Xn + Yn = Zn, Where N Represents 3, 4, 5, ...no Solution I Have Discovered A Truly Marvelous Demonstration Of This Proposition Which This Margin Is Too Narrow To Contain. With These Words, The Seventeenth-century French Mathematician Pierre De Fermat Threw Down The Gauntlet To Future Generations. What Came To Be Known As Fermat's Last Theorem Looked Simple; Proving It, However, Became The Holy Grail Of Mathematics, Baffling Its Finest Minds For More Than 350 Years. In Fermat's Enigma--based On The Author's Award-winning Documentary Film, Which Aired On Pbs's Nova--simon Singh Tells The Astonishingly Entertaining Story Of The Pursuit Of That Grail, And The Lives That Were Devoted To, Sacrificed For, And Saved By It.
